Product Introduction

Overview

The 74AUP1G38GW,125 is a single-channel NAND gate integrated circuit produced by NXP Semiconductors. This component is part of the 74AUP family, known for its low power consumption and high noise immunity. It is packaged in a 5-TSSOP (Thin Shrink Small Outline Package) and is suitable for a wide range of applications requiring logical operations.

Key Features

  • Low power consumption: The IC operates with a very low current consumption, making it suitable for battery-powered devices.
  • High noise immunity: The component is designed to provide high noise immunity, ensuring reliable operation in noisy environments.
  • Wide supply voltage range: It can operate over a wide supply voltage range from 0.8 V to 3.6 V, making it versatile for various applications.
  • Compact packaging: The 5-TSSOP package is compact and suitable for space-constrained designs.
